
Consulting • SaaS • Energy
ICF is a global consulting and technology services company that helps government and commercial clients tackle complex challenges. The firm provides expertise in areas such as Federal IT modernization, energy and utilities, public health, climate resilience, disaster management, and transportation. ICF leverages data and analytics, artificial intelligence, and cybersecurity to deliver innovative solutions. With a strong commitment to corporate citizenship and sustainability, ICF supports social programs and community development, aiming for a sustainable, low-emissions future. The company operates worldwide, with significant presence in Europe through its offices in Belgium, Spain, and the UK.
5001 - 10000 employees
Founded 1969
☁️ SaaS
⚡ Energy
💰 $30M Grant on 2021-03
October 28
⚔️ Virginia – Remote
💵 $67k - $113.9k / year
⏰ Full Time
🟡 Mid-level
🟠 Senior
🔧 QA Engineer (Quality Assurance)
🦅 H1B Visa Sponsor

Consulting • SaaS • Energy
ICF is a global consulting and technology services company that helps government and commercial clients tackle complex challenges. The firm provides expertise in areas such as Federal IT modernization, energy and utilities, public health, climate resilience, disaster management, and transportation. ICF leverages data and analytics, artificial intelligence, and cybersecurity to deliver innovative solutions. With a strong commitment to corporate citizenship and sustainability, ICF supports social programs and community development, aiming for a sustainable, low-emissions future. The company operates worldwide, with significant presence in Europe through its offices in Belgium, Spain, and the UK.
5001 - 10000 employees
Founded 1969
☁️ SaaS
⚡ Energy
💰 $30M Grant on 2021-03
• Review and analyze business requirements to produce comprehensive, and well-structured test strategy and test cases. • Design and create test conditions and scripts to address business and technical use cases. • Design, Develop and Execute automated scripts using our test automation framework. • Support the automated functional testing by our testing team, focusing on application flow and validation of test results. • Perform manual and automated testing, which may include exploratory, system, regression, compatibility, system, and integration testing. • Work directly with the Data Warehouse, Business Intelligence and Data Engineering teams to ensure all work is thoroughly tested. • Communicate effectively across multiple teams/external vendors (Operations, Quality Service, etc.), as well as different personnel (Developers, Scrum Masters, Project Managers, etc.). • Participate in relevant Agile Ceremonies: Daily Stand-Ups, Backlog Grooming, Sprint Planning, Sprint Reviews and Retrospectives. • Analyze data and application changes and document their impact on the performance automation task (test cases, scripting, scenario execution, etc.). • Ensure the test execution results fulfill the defined test objectives. • Interface directly with the DevOps and Infrastructure teams regarding Functional test environments. • Timely and accurate communication of testing events, daily status, and test execution results, etc. • Develop and maintain automation for both UI and API testing, leveraging tools such as Playwright, Cypress, Selenium, PyTest, and Postman. • Implement automated regression suites integrated into CI/CD pipelines (e.g., GitHub Actions, Jenkins, or similar). • Collaborate with developers to validate microservices, containerized environments, and AWS-hosted applications. • Design performance, load, and reliability test scenarios to validate large-scale data processing and reporting systems.
• Bachelor’s degree OR completion of 6+ weeks of a programming boot camp plus 1+ year of IT-related experience; OR 4 years of relevant industry experience without a formal degree • 3+ years of experience with test automation development (eg : Cypress, Ruby, Playwright, JS, Python, Selenium). • Must be able to obtain and maintain a Public Trust clearance • Must have lived in the US 3 full years out of the last 5 years • Must reside in the US, be authorized to work in the US; work must be performed in the US. • Strong hands-on skills in SQL development; ability to create ad-hoc queries to meet business needs. • Experience working with cloud-native environments (AWS preferred), microservices, and infrastructure-as-code pipelines. • Familiarity with monitoring/logging tools (e.g., Splunk, CloudWatch, New Relic) to validate releases and production health.
• ICF is an equal opportunity employer. • Reasonable Accommodations are available. • Professional development opportunities
Apply NowOctober 28
Lead Quality Assurance Engineer improving testing processes and ensuring product quality for TrendSpider's automated technical analysis software. Collaborate with traders and developers in a remote-first environment.
🗣️🇷🇺 Russian Required
🗣️🇺🇦 Ukrainian Required
JavaScript
Puppeteer
October 27
Senior QA Engineer at Underdog Sports leading quality strategy and execution across gaming platforms. Collaborating with teams to embed reliability and testability into product development.
October 26
Senior Manager responsible for Quality Assurance and Compliance overseeing operational areas and ensuring adherence to regulations in Medicare Advantage services. Leading efforts to maintain high quality standards across operations.
🇺🇸 United States – Remote
💵 $125.4k - $181.4k / year
⏰ Full Time
🟠 Senior
🔧 QA Engineer (Quality Assurance)
October 26
QA Analyst ensuring product quality across SaaS platform, validating releases and triaging customer issues with opportunity for automation. Join a fully remote team impacting customer data in regulated industries.
🇺🇸 United States – Remote
💵 $85k - $95k / year
⏰ Full Time
🟡 Mid-level
🟠 Senior
🔧 QA Engineer (Quality Assurance)
🦅 H1B Visa Sponsor
October 25
Clinical Quality Assurance Coordinator ensuring compliance and quality assurance for case reports. Handling quality assurance questions and supporting the Quality Assurance Department to meet standards.
🇺🇸 United States – Remote
💵 $24 - $31 / hour
⏰ Full Time
🟢 Junior
🟡 Mid-level
🔧 QA Engineer (Quality Assurance)
🚫👨🎓 No degree required